OVERVIEW The Student Immigration Compliance & Advice Officer at Birkbeck, University of London plays a key administrative role in supporting international students and safeguarding the institution’s ability to sponsor student visas. Based within the International Student Administration team in Registry Services, the role combines operational compliance work with direct student-facing support. It is well suited to an administrator who is organised, confident with systems, and motivated to build expertise in student immigration processes. KEY RESPONSIBILITIES – Support the International Student Administration team within Registry Services. – Help maintain the University’s Student Visa sponsor licence. – Process Confirmations of Acceptance for Studies (CAS). – Undertake student visa compliance checks. – Provide basic immigration advice and support to international students and applicants. REQUIREMENTS – Experience working as an administrator. – Excellent IT skills. – Strong organisational skills. – Eagerness to learn and develop new skills. WHY THIS ROLE MATTERS This role is central to ensuring that international students can study at Birkbeck with the appropriate immigration permission and ongoing support. Effective compliance and accurate administration protect the University’s sponsor licence, which is essential for maintaining access to global talent. By supporting students and applicants through complex processes, the role also contributes directly to the student experience and institutional reputation.
